Abstract To identify the adopted Islamic architectural design elements in the religious and secular buildings of Nepal, the studied parameters are confined to mosque and temple complexes, which show the reflection and amalgamation of borrowed architectural style from neighbouring countries. Islamic design principles and elements of Mughal architecture from North India due to the migration of Muslims have been integrated into the building design in Nepal. This architectural characteristic is visible in the master plan, layout plan, roof (dome) and elevation as well as arches and window openings with window screen, niches, and geometric design patterns used in the decoration of building facades, floorings, roofs, ceilings, landscapes and water bodies. Being a land-lock between India and China, the country's architecture has evolved with an exchange of regional art, culture, and tradition.
